Profile
A Long-time Favourite
There’s a reason why Felico’s has been in business for more than 25 years: authentic Greek cooking, generous servings, and value for money. Since opening in 1984 as the only Greek restaurant in Richmond, it has attracted and kept a loyal clientele. Many ingredients are made in-house, based on family recipes that have been passed on from generation to generation. Business has been so good the restaurant underwent a massive renovation in 2008, adding polish and elegance for a truly memorable dining experience.
Sophisticated Dining
Felico’s has taken traditional Greek restaurant décor — white plaster walls, rustic pottery, travel posters of white villages perched above an azure sea — several notches higher, creating an upscale, modern space in muted colours and sexy mood lighting. Have a drink at the bar/lounge area or catch up on sports scores on one of the two flat-screen TVs. With room for 140 indoors and another 25 on the heated patio, as well as a main dining rom and three private areas, Felico’s is a great place for a romantic dinner, family reunion, or corporate function.
Big, Fat Greek Dishes
Felico’s serves authentic Greek dishes, inspired largely by family recipes from the sun-drenched island of Cyprus. Some of the restaurant’s trademark dishes include roasted lamb, lightly-battered calamari, kleftico, dolmathes and Feta Kota, a baked chicken dish garnished with spinach and feta cheese. Felico’s is licensed, so enjoy a shot or two of ouzo, or order the restaurant’s signature drink: the Big, Fat Greek Martini, made with a blend of vodka, lemon, and lime, triple sec and blue curacao.
